SSM+Vue图书管理系统开题报告.docx
【SSM+Vue图书管理系统开题报告】 图书管理系统设计与实现是计算机科学领域的一个常见课题,尤其对于毕业设计和论文阶段的学生来说,这样的项目既能够锻炼编程能力,又能够实际解决现实问题。本项目旨在利用现代信息技术,如SpringBoot、SSM(Spring、SpringMVC、MyBatis)和Vue.js前端框架,构建一个高效、可靠的图书管理系统,以改善传统图书管理的手工操作效率低、易出错的问题。 一、项目背景与现状 当前,许多图书馆的图书管理工作仍依赖于人工,这种方式不仅效率低下,而且难以实时掌握图书种类和读者需求。人为因素可能导致数据丢失或错误,不适应信息化时代的需求。计算机信息化管理则具备存储量大、处理速度快等优势,能够提供及时、快捷的信息处理,因此,利用计算机技术构建图书管理系统是势在必行的。 二、项目意义 本项目的实施将结合计算信息时代的进步和现代管理理念,创建一个高效、便捷的图书管理系统。系统不仅能优化图书管理流程,提高工作效率,还能使用户随时随地获取图书信息,方便借阅,进一步促进知识传播。 三、系统架构与功能模块 1. 读者信息管理:支持浏览、添加、删除和修改读者信息。 2. 图书信息管理:可查看图书信息,包括图书的添加、删除和修改,以及书架管理。 3. 图书借还管理:提供读者借阅和归还图书的功能。 4. 用户信息管理:实现用户注册、修改个人信息,并进行权限管理,保障系统安全。 四、研究方法 1. 文献研究法:通过查阅相关文献,获取研究所需的基础资料,全面了解研究内容。 2. 调查法:收集研究对象的详细信息,为系统设计提供依据。 3. 实证研究法:根据现有理论和实际需求,设计并实施图书管理系统。 五、参考资料 本项目参考了多篇相关文献,涉及图书馆管理的计算机化、用户需求分析、图书馆服务质量提升、图书管理信息系统设计等多个方面,为项目提供了理论和技术支持。 SSM+Vue图书管理系统将结合后端的SpringBoot框架,实现服务端逻辑;SSM中的Spring负责依赖注入,SpringMVC处理HTTP请求,MyBatis处理数据库操作;Vue.js作为前端框架,提供用户友好的交互界面。通过这一系统,可以显著提升图书馆的管理效率,同时满足用户多样化的信息查询和借阅需求。
- 粉丝: 3706
- 资源: 5223
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助